NOTE¡¡TO¡¡CHAPTER¡¡XXXI
Note¡¡F¡£¡Ulrica's¡¡Death¡¡song¡£
It¡¡will¡¡readily¡¡occur¡¡to¡¡the¡¡antiquary£»¡¡that¡¡these¡¡verses¡¡are
intended¡¡to¡¡imitate¡¡the¡¡antique¡¡poetry¡¡of¡¡the¡¡Scalds¡the¡¡minstrels
of¡¡the¡¡old¡¡Scandinavians¡the¡¡race£»¡¡as¡¡the¡¡Laureate¡¡so¡¡happily
terms¡¡them£»
¡®¡®Stern¡¡to¡¡inflict£»¡¡and¡¡stubborn¡¡to¡¡endure£»
Who¡¡smiled¡¡in¡¡death¡£''
The¡¡poetry¡¡of¡¡the¡¡Anglo¡Saxons£»¡¡after¡¡their¡¡civilisation¡¡and
conversion£»¡¡was¡¡of¡¡a¡¡different¡¡and¡¡softer¡¡character£»¡¡but¡¡in¡¡the
circumstances¡¡of¡¡Ulrica£»¡¡she¡¡may¡¡be¡¡not¡¡unnaturally¡¡supposed
to¡¡return¡¡to¡¡the¡¡wild¡¡strains¡¡which¡¡animated¡¡her¡¡forefathers
during¡¡the¡¡time¡¡of¡¡Paganism¡¡and¡¡untamed¡¡ferocity¡£
NOTE¡¡TO¡¡CHAPTER¡¡XXXII
Note¡¡G¡£¡Richard¡¡Cur¡de¡Lion¡£
The¡¡interchange¡¡of¡¡a¡¡cuff¡¡with¡¡the¡¡jolly¡¡priest¡¡is¡¡not¡¡entirely
out¡¡of¡¡character¡¡with¡¡Richard¡¡I¡££»¡¡if¡¡romances¡¡read¡¡him¡¡aright¡£¡¡¡¡
In¡¡the¡¡very¡¡curious¡¡romance¡¡on¡¡the¡¡subject¡¡of¡¡his¡¡adventures
in¡¡the¡¡Holy¡¡Land£»¡¡and¡¡his¡¡return¡¡from¡¡thence£»¡¡it¡¡is¡¡recorded
how¡¡he¡¡exchanged¡¡a¡¡pugilistic¡¡favour¡¡of¡¡this¡¡nature£»¡¡while¡¡a
prisoner¡¡in¡¡Germany¡£¡¡¡¡His¡¡opponent¡¡was¡¡the¡¡son¡¡of¡¡his¡¡principal
warder£»¡¡and¡¡was¡¡so¡¡imprudent¡¡as¡¡to¡¡give¡¡the¡¡challenge¡¡to
this¡¡barter¡¡of¡¡buffets¡£¡¡¡¡The¡¡King¡¡stood¡¡forth¡¡like¡¡a¡¡true¡¡man£»
and¡¡received¡¡a¡¡blow¡¡which¡¡staggered¡¡him¡£¡¡¡¡In¡¡requital£»¡¡having
previously¡¡waxed¡¡his¡¡hand£»¡¡a¡¡practice¡¡unknown£»¡¡I¡¡believe£»¡¡to
the¡¡gentlemen¡¡of¡¡the¡¡modern¡¡fancy£»¡¡he¡¡returned¡¡the¡¡box¡¡on¡¡the
ear¡¡with¡¡such¡¡interest¡¡as¡¡to¡¡kill¡¡his¡¡antagonist¡¡on¡¡the¡¡spot¡£¡_See£»
in¡¡Ellis's¡¡Specimens¡¡of¡¡English¡¡Romance£»¡¡that¡¡of¡¡Cur¡de¡Lion_¡£
NOTE¡¡TO¡¡CHAPTER¡¡XXXIII
Note¡¡H¡£¡Hedge¡Priests¡£
It¡¡is¡¡curious¡¡to¡¡observe£»¡¡that¡¡in¡¡every¡¡state¡¡of¡¡society£»¡¡some
sort¡¡of¡¡ghostly¡¡consolation¡¡is¡¡provided¡¡for¡¡the¡¡members¡¡of¡¡the
community£»¡¡though¡¡assembled¡¡for¡¡purposes¡¡diametrically¡¡opposite
to¡¡religion¡£¡¡¡¡A¡¡gang¡¡of¡¡beggars¡¡have¡¡their¡¡Patrico£»¡¡and
the¡¡banditti¡¡of¡¡the¡¡Apennines¡¡have¡¡among¡¡them¡¡persons¡¡acting
as¡¡monks¡¡and¡¡priests£»¡¡by¡¡whom¡¡they¡¡are¡¡confessed£»¡¡and¡¡who
perform¡¡mass¡¡before¡¡them¡£¡¡¡¡Unquestionably£»¡¡such¡¡reverend
persons£»¡¡in¡¡such¡¡a¡¡society£»¡¡must¡¡accommodate¡¡their¡¡manners
and¡¡their¡¡morals¡¡to¡¡the¡¡community¡¡in¡¡which¡¡they¡¡live£»¡¡and¡¡if
they¡¡can¡¡occasionally¡¡obtain¡¡a¡¡degree¡¡of¡¡reverence¡¡for¡¡their¡¡supposed
spiritual¡¡gifts£»¡¡are£»¡¡on¡¡most¡¡occasions£»¡¡loaded¡¡with¡¡unmerciful
ridicule£»¡¡as¡¡possessing¡¡a¡¡character¡¡inconsistent¡¡with¡¡all
around¡¡them¡£
Hence¡¡the¡¡fighting¡¡parson¡¡in¡¡the¡¡old¡¡play¡¡of¡¡Sir¡¡John¡¡Oldcastle£»
and¡¡the¡¡famous¡¡friar¡¡of¡¡Robin¡¡Hood's¡¡band¡£¡¡¡¡Nor¡¡were
such¡¡characters¡¡ideal¡£¡¡¡¡There¡¡exists¡¡a¡¡monition¡¡of¡¡the¡¡Bishop
of¡¡Durham¡¡against¡¡irregular¡¡churchmen¡¡of¡¡this¡¡class£»¡¡who¡¡associated
themselves¡¡with¡¡Border¡¡robbers£»¡¡and¡¡desecrated¡¡the
holiest¡¡offices¡¡of¡¡the¡¡priestly¡¡function£»¡¡by¡¡celebrating¡¡them¡¡for
the¡¡benefit¡¡of¡¡thieves£»¡¡robbers£»¡¡and¡¡murderers£»¡¡amongst¡¡ruins
and¡¡in¡¡caverns¡¡of¡¡the¡¡earth£»¡¡without¡¡regard¡¡to¡¡canonical¡¡form£»
and¡¡with¡¡torn¡¡and¡¡dirty¡¡attire£»¡¡and¡¡maimed¡¡rites£»¡¡altogether
improper¡¡for¡¡the¡¡occasion¡£
NOTE¡¡TO¡¡CHAPTER¡¡XLI¡£
Note¡¡I¡£¡Castle¡¡of¡¡Coningsburgh¡£
When¡¡I¡¡last¡¡saw¡¡this¡¡interesting¡¡ruin¡¡of¡¡ancient¡¡days£»¡¡one
of¡¡the¡¡very¡¡few¡¡remaining¡¡examples¡¡of¡¡Saxon¡¡fortification£»¡¡I
was¡¡strongly¡¡impressed¡¡with¡¡the¡¡desire¡¡of¡¡tracing¡¡out¡¡a¡¡sort¡¡of
theory¡¡on¡¡the¡¡subject£»¡¡which£»¡¡from¡¡some¡¡recent¡¡acquaintance
with¡¡the¡¡architecture¡¡of¡¡the¡¡ancient¡¡Scandinavians£»¡¡seemed¡¡to
me¡¡peculiarly¡¡interesting¡£¡¡¡¡I¡¡was£»¡¡however£»¡¡obliged¡¡by¡¡circumstances
to¡¡proceed¡¡on¡¡my¡¡journey£»¡¡without¡¡leisure¡¡to¡¡take¡¡more
than¡¡a¡¡transient¡¡view¡¡of¡¡Coningsburgh¡£¡¡¡¡Yet¡¡the¡¡idea¡¡dwells¡¡so
strongly¡¡in¡¡my¡¡mind£»¡¡that¡¡I¡¡feel¡¡considerably¡¡tempted¡¡to¡¡write
a¡¡page¡¡or¡¡two¡¡in¡¡detailing¡¡at¡¡least¡¡the¡¡outline¡¡of¡¡my¡¡hypothesis£»
leaving¡¡better¡¡antiquaries¡¡to¡¡correct¡¡or¡¡refute¡¡conclusions
which¡¡are¡¡perhaps¡¡too¡¡hastily¡¡drawn¡£
Those¡¡who¡¡have¡¡visited¡¡the¡¡Zetland¡¡Islands£»¡¡are¡¡familiar¡¡with
the¡¡description¡¡of¡¡castles¡¡called¡¡by¡¡the¡¡inhabitants¡¡Burghs£»¡¡and¡¡by
the¡¡Highlanders¡for¡¡they¡¡are¡¡also¡¡to¡¡be¡¡found¡¡both¡¡in¡¡the¡¡Western
Isles¡¡and¡¡on¡¡the¡¡mainland¡Duns¡£¡¡¡¡Pennant¡¡has¡¡engraved
a¡¡view¡¡of¡¡the¡¡famous¡¡Dun¡Dornadilla¡¡in¡¡Glenelg£»¡¡and¡¡there¡¡are
many¡¡others£»¡¡all¡¡of¡¡them¡¡built¡¡after¡¡a¡¡peculiar¡¡mode¡¡of¡¡architecture£»
which¡¡argues¡¡a¡¡people¡¡in¡¡the¡¡most¡¡primitive¡¡state¡¡of¡¡society¡£¡¡¡¡
The¡¡most¡¡perfect¡¡specimen¡¡is¡¡that¡¡upon¡¡the¡¡island¡¡of¡¡Mousa£»
near¡¡to¡¡the¡¡mainland¡¡of¡¡Zetland£»¡¡which¡¡is¡¡probably¡¡in¡¡the
same¡¡state¡¡as¡¡when¡¡inhabited¡£
It¡¡is¡¡a¡¡single¡¡round¡¡tower£»¡¡the¡¡wall¡¡curving¡¡in¡¡slightly£»¡¡and
then¡¡turning¡¡outward¡¡again¡¡in¡¡the¡¡form¡¡of¡¡a¡¡dice¡box£»¡¡so¡¡that
the¡¡defenders¡¡on¡¡the¡¡top¡¡might¡¡the¡¡better¡¡protect¡¡the¡¡base¡£¡¡¡¡
It¡¡is¡¡formed¡¡of¡¡rough¡¡stones£»¡¡selected¡¡with¡¡care£»¡¡and¡¡laid¡¡in
courses¡¡or¡¡circles£»¡¡with¡¡much¡¡compactness£»¡¡but¡¡without¡¡cement
of¡¡any¡¡kind¡£¡¡¡¡The¡¡tower¡¡has¡¡never£»¡¡to¡¡appearance£»¡¡had¡¡roofing
of¡¡any¡¡sort£»¡¡a¡¡fire¡¡was¡¡made¡¡in¡¡the¡¡centre¡¡of¡¡the¡¡space¡¡which
it¡¡encloses£»¡¡and¡¡originally¡¡the¡¡building¡¡was¡¡probably¡¡little¡¡more
than¡¡a¡¡wall¡¡drawn¡¡as¡¡a¡¡sort¡¡of¡¡screen¡¡around¡¡the¡¡great¡¡council
fire¡¡of¡¡the¡¡tribe¡£¡¡¡¡But£»¡¡although¡¡the¡¡means¡¡or¡¡ingenuity¡¡of
the¡¡builders¡¡did¡¡not¡¡extend¡¡so¡¡far¡¡as¡¡to¡¡provide¡¡a¡¡roof£»¡¡they¡¡supplied
the¡¡want¡¡by¡¡constructing¡¡apartments¡¡in¡¡the¡¡interior¡¡of
the¡¡walls¡¡of¡¡the¡¡tower¡¡itself¡£¡¡¡¡The¡¡circumvallation¡¡formed¡¡a
double¡¡enclosure£»¡¡the¡¡inner¡¡side¡¡of¡¡which¡¡was£»¡¡in¡¡fact£»¡¡two¡¡feet
or¡¡three¡¡feet¡¡distant¡¡from¡¡the¡¡other£»¡¡and¡¡connected¡¡by¡¡a¡¡concentric
range¡¡of¡¡long¡¡flat¡¡stones£»¡¡thus¡¡forming¡¡a¡¡series¡¡of¡¡concentric
rings¡¡or¡¡stories¡¡of¡¡various¡¡heights£»¡¡rising¡¡to¡¡the¡¡top¡¡of¡¡the¡¡tower¡£¡¡¡¡
Each¡¡of¡¡these¡¡stories¡¡or¡¡galleries¡¡has¡¡four¡¡windows£»¡¡facing
directly¡¡to¡¡the¡¡points¡¡of¡¡the¡¡compass£»¡¡and¡¡rising¡¡of¡¡course¡¡regularly
above¡¡each¡¡other¡£¡¡¡¡These¡¡four¡¡perpendicular¡¡ranges¡¡of¡¡windows
admitted¡¡air£»¡¡and£»¡¡the¡¡fire¡¡being¡¡kindled£»¡¡heat£»¡¡or¡¡smoke¡¡at
least£»¡¡to¡¡each¡¡of¡¡the¡¡galleries¡£¡¡¡¡The¡¡access¡¡from¡¡gallery¡¡to¡¡gallery
is¡¡equally¡¡primitive¡£¡¡A¡¡path£»¡¡on¡¡the¡¡principle¡¡of¡¡an¡¡inclined
plane£»¡¡turns¡¡round¡¡and¡¡round¡¡the¡¡building¡¡like¡¡a¡¡screw£»¡¡and¡¡gives
access¡¡to¡¡the¡¡different¡¡stories£»¡¡intersecting¡¡each¡¡of¡¡them¡¡in¡¡its
turn£»¡¡and¡¡thus¡¡gradually¡¡rising¡¡to¡¡the¡¡top¡¡of¡¡the¡¡wall¡¡of¡¡the
tower¡£¡¡¡¡On¡¡the¡¡outside¡¡there¡¡are¡¡no¡¡windows¡¡£»¡¡and¡¡I¡¡may¡¡add£»
that¡¡an¡¡enclosure¡¡of¡¡a¡¡square£»¡¡or¡¡sometimes¡¡a¡¡round¡¡form£»¡¡gave
the¡¡inhabitants¡¡of¡¡the¡¡Burgh¡¡an¡¡opportunity¡¡to¡¡secure¡¡any
sheep¡¡or¡¡cattle¡¡which¡¡they¡¡might¡¡possess¡£
Such¡¡is¡¡the¡¡general¡¡architecture¡¡of¡¡that¡¡very¡¡early¡¡period
when¡¡the¡¡Northmen¡¡swept¡¡the¡¡seas£»¡¡and¡¡brought¡¡to¡¡their
rude¡¡houses£»¡¡such¡¡as¡¡I¡¡have¡¡described¡¡them£»¡¡the¡¡plunder¡¡of
polished¡¡nations¡£¡¡¡¡In¡¡Zetland¡¡there¡¡are¡¡several¡¡scores¡¡of¡¡these
Burghs£»¡¡occupying¡¡in¡¡every¡¡case£»¡¡capes£»¡¡headlands£»¡¡islets£»¡¡and¡¡similar
places¡¡of¡¡advantage¡¡singularly¡¡well¡¡chosen¡£¡¡¡¡I¡¡remember
the¡¡remains¡¡of¡¡one¡¡upon¡¡an¡¡island¡¡in¡¡a¡¡small¡¡lake¡¡near¡¡Lerwick£»
which¡¡at¡¡high¡¡tide¡¡communicates¡¡with¡¡the¡¡sea£»¡¡the¡¡access¡¡to
which¡¡is¡¡very¡¡ingenious£»¡¡by¡¡means¡¡of¡¡a¡¡causeway¡¡or¡¡dike£»
about¡¡three¡¡or¡¡four¡¡inches¡¡under¡¡the¡¡surface¡¡of¡¡the¡¡water¡£¡¡¡¡This
causeway¡¡makes¡¡a¡¡sharp¡¡angle¡¡in¡¡its¡¡approach¡¡to¡¡the¡¡Burgh¡£¡¡¡¡
The¡¡inhabitants£»¡¡doubtless£»¡¡were¡¡well¡¡acquainted¡¡with¡¡this£»¡¡but
strangers£»¡¡who¡¡might¡¡approach¡¡in¡¡a¡¡hostile¡¡manner£»¡¡and¡¡were
ignorant¡¡of¡¡the¡¡curve¡¡of¡¡the¡¡causeway£»¡¡would¡¡probably¡¡plunge
into¡¡the¡¡lake£»¡¡which¡¡is¡¡six¡¡or¡¡seven¡¡feet¡¡in¡¡depth¡¡at¡¡the¡¡least¡£¡¡¡¡
This¡¡must¡¡have¡¡been¡¡the¡¡device¡¡of¡¡some¡¡Vauban¡¡or¡¡Cohorn¡¡of
those¡¡early¡¡times¡£
The¡¡style¡¡of¡¡these¡¡buildings¡¡evinces¡¡that¡¡the¡¡architect¡¡possessed
neither¡¡the¡¡art¡¡of¡¡using¡¡lime¡¡or¡¡cement¡¡of¡¡any¡¡kind£»¡¡nor
the¡¡skill¡¡to¡¡throw¡¡an¡¡arch£»¡¡construct¡¡a¡¡roof£»¡¡or¡¡erect¡¡a¡¡stair¡¡£»
and¡¡yet£»¡¡with¡¡all¡¡this¡¡ignorance£»¡¡showed¡¡great¡¡ingenuity¡¡in¡¡selecting
the¡¡situation¡¡of¡¡Burghs£»¡¡and¡¡regulating¡¡the¡¡access¡¡to
them£»¡¡as¡¡well¡¡as¡¡neatness¡¡and¡¡regularity¡¡in¡¡the¡¡erection£»¡¡since
the¡¡buildings¡¡themselves¡¡show¡¡a¡¡style¡¡of¡¡advance¡¡in¡¡the¡¡arts
scarcely¡¡consistent¡¡with¡¡the¡¡ignorance¡¡of¡¡so¡¡many¡¡of¡¡the¡¡principal
branches¡¡of¡¡architectural¡¡knowledge¡£
I¡¡have¡¡always¡¡thought£»¡¡that¡¡one¡¡of¡¡the¡¡most¡¡curious¡¡and¡¡valuable
objects¡¡of¡¡antiquaries¡¡has¡¡been¡¡to¡¡trace¡¡the¡¡progress¡¡of
society£»¡¡by¡¡the¡¡efforts¡¡made¡¡in¡¡early¡¡ages¡¡to¡¡improve¡¡the¡¡rudeness
of¡¡their¡¡first¡¡expedients£»¡¡until¡¡they¡¡either¡¡approach¡¡excellence£»
or£»¡¡as¡¡is¡¡more¡¡frequently¡¡the¡¡case£»¡¡are¡¡supplied¡¡by¡¡new¡¡and
fundamental¡¡discoveries£»¡¡which¡¡supersede¡¡both¡¡the¡¡earlier¡¡and
ruder¡¡system£»¡¡and¡¡the¡¡improvements¡¡which¡¡have¡¡been¡¡ingrafted
upon¡¡it¡£¡¡¡¡For¡¡example£»¡¡if¡¡we¡¡conceive¡¡the¡¡recent¡¡discovery
of¡¡gas¡¡to¡¡be¡¡so¡¡much¡¡improved¡¡and¡¡adapted¡¡to¡¡domestic¡¡use£»¡¡as
to¡¡supersede¡¡all¡¡other¡¡modes¡¡of¡¡producing¡¡domestic¡¡light£»¡¡we
can¡¡already¡¡suppose£»¡¡some¡¡centuries¡¡afterwards£»¡¡the¡¡heads¡¡of¡¡a
whole¡¡Society¡¡of¡¡Antiquaries¡¡half¡¡turned¡¡by¡¡the¡¡discovery¡¡of¡¡a
pair¡¡of¡¡patent¡¡snuffers£»¡¡and¡¡by¡¡the¡¡learned¡¡theories¡¡which¡¡would
be¡¡brought¡¡forward¡¡to¡¡account¡¡for¡¡the¡¡form¡¡and¡¡purpose¡¡of¡¡so
singular¡¡an¡¡implement¡£
Following¡¡some¡¡such¡¡principle£»¡¡I¡¡am¡¡inclined¡¡to¡¡regard¡¡the
singular¡¡Castle¡¡of¡¡Coningsburgh¡I¡¡mean¡¡the¡¡Saxon¡¡part¡¡of¡¡it¡
as¡¡a¡¡step¡¡in¡¡advance¡¡from¡¡the¡¡rude¡¡architecture£»¡¡if¡¡it¡¡deserves
the¡¡name£»¡¡which¡¡must¡¡have¡¡been¡¡common¡¡to¡¡the¡¡Saxons¡¡as¡¡to
other¡¡Northmen¡£¡¡¡¡The¡¡builders¡¡had¡¡attained¡¡the¡¡art¡¡of¡¡using
cement£»¡¡and¡¡of¡¡roofing¡¡a¡¡building£»¡great¡¡improvements¡¡on¡¡the
original¡¡Burgh¡£¡¡¡¡But¡¡in¡¡the¡¡round¡¡keep£»¡¡a¡¡shape¡¡only¡¡seen¡¡in
the¡¡most¡¡ancient¡¡castles¡the¡¡chambers¡¡excavated¡¡in¡¡the¡¡thickness
of¡¡the¡¡walls¡¡and¡¡buttresses¡the¡¡difficulty¡¡by¡¡which¡¡access
is¡¡gained¡¡from¡¡one¡¡story¡¡to¡¡those¡¡above¡¡it£»¡¡Coningsburgh¡¡still
retains¡¡the¡¡simplicity¡¡of¡¡its¡¡origin£»¡¡and¡¡shows¡¡by¡¡what¡¡slow
degrees¡¡man¡¡proceeded¡¡from¡¡occupying¡¡such¡¡rude¡¡and¡¡inconvenient
lodgings£»¡¡as¡¡were¡¡afforded¡¡by¡¡the¡¡galleries¡¡of¡¡the¡¡Castle
of¡¡Mousa£»¡¡to¡¡the¡¡more¡¡splendid¡¡accommodations¡¡of¡¡the¡¡Norman
castles£»¡¡with¡¡all¡¡their¡¡stern¡¡and¡¡Gothic¡¡graces¡£
I¡¡am¡¡ignorant¡¡if¡¡these¡¡remarks¡¡are¡¡new£»¡¡or¡¡if¡¡they¡¡will¡¡be
confirmed¡¡by¡¡closer¡¡examination¡¡£»¡¡but¡¡I¡¡think£»¡¡that£»¡¡on¡¡a¡¡hasty
observation£»¡¡Coningsburgh¡¡offers¡¡means¡¡of¡¡curious¡¡study¡¡to
those¡¡who¡¡may¡¡wish¡¡to¡¡trace¡¡the¡¡history¡¡of¡¡architecture¡¡back
to¡¡the¡¡times¡¡preceding¡¡the¡¡Norman¡¡Conquest¡£
It¡¡would¡¡be¡¡highly¡¡desirable¡¡that¡¡a¡¡cork¡¡model¡¡should¡¡be
taken¡¡of¡¡the¡¡Castle¡¡of¡¡Mousa£»¡¡as¡¡it¡¡cannot¡¡be¡¡well¡¡understood¡¡by
a¡¡plan¡£
